WE understand that the contributors to the next volume of the Zoological Record are as follows:—Mammalia, Reptilia, and Pisces, Dr. Albert Günther, F.R.S.; Aves, Mr. H. E. Dresser, F.Z.S., and Mr. R. B. Sharpe, F.L.S.; Mollusca, Molluscoidea, and Crustacea, Dr. Edward von Martens, F.M.Z.S.; Arachnida and Myriapoda, Mr. O. Pickard-Cambridge, C.M.Z.S.; Insecta generally and Coleoptera, Mr. E. C. Rye; Lepidoptera, Mr. W. F. Küby; Diptera, G. A. Verrall; Neuroptera and Orthoptera, Mr. M'Lachlan; Rhynchota, Mr. John Scott; Vermes, Mr. E. Ray Lankester; Echinodermata, Cœlenterata, and Protozoa, Prof. Traquair. Respecting the work and the association which has been formed to prosecute it, we spoke at some length a few weeks ago, and will only remind our readers that the secretary of the Zoological Record Association is Mr. H. T. Stainton, F.R.S., to whom all applications for further information on the subject should be addressed.
